Bristol Rovers Women's are just one point away from securing the South West Women's Football League at the first attempt.

An emphatic 6-0 victory at home to Cheltenham Town Development last Sunday, put the 'Gas Girls' within touching distance of mathematically clinching a second league title in a row. Weston Mendip Ladies will be making the journey to North Bristol on Sunday, in a bid to halt proceedings at Lockleaze Sports Centre and gain further advantage from their local rivals at the bottom of the table, Weston-Super-Mare Ladies.
 
Re-launched in 2019, the 'Gas Girls' recorded a 100% record in the Gloucestershire County Women's League (Tier 7 of the English Women's Football Pyramid) before the season was declared null & void due to the Covid-19 pandemic. The following the season saw Rovers clinch their first league title and promotion to the South West Regional League for 2021/22.
 
The 'Gas Girls' have enjoyed an impressive debut season in the Northern Division of the SWWFL, recording twelve wins in fourteen games and scoring a superb 67 goals, with the help of Zoe Fielden-Stewart, Annys Turner and Laura Curnock.
 
First-Team Manager, Nathan Hallett-Young, said "The girls have been superb and we'll be going into Sunday's game with the same mentality as we've carried throughout the season. We've been so impressed with their attitude and determination to succeed, especially considering that they're amateur players and have many other commitments. They're so proud to represent Bristol Rovers and they certainly deserve the support from the Gas Family"
